Transaction c5f2ba3072b4662ab36d1e15473ce2b51eb239a65e46e5c2f33fe17eb954c142

2 Input
1 Outputs
  • c5f2ba3072b4662ab36d1e15473ce2b51eb239a65e46e5c2f33fe17eb954c142:0
  • value  20531758
    address  3BmyB69Aaoe1eFJvYCH5zGSpJcSEuVsouh